A garage can be transformed into a workshop, which is a great way of repurposing your space for DIY projects. It can be daunting, but the results are worth it.

Typically, the first step is to clear out any junk and clutter that has accumulated in your garage over time. This could include lawnmowers, old equipment, garden equipment, unused machinery, or anything else you no longer use in your garage.

Once you have cleared the space, you can start mapping out a layout for your new workspace. This will help to decide how much space should you give yourself, and what kind of projects to work on.

Make sure to designate a section for raw materials, tools, machinery and trash and scraps. This will stop everything getting mixed up.

It is also worth considering creating a storage place that allows you to store tools and supplies you frequently use. You can use plastic bins or a shelf organizer to store your tools. For more specialized equipment or items, you could also use a larger, heavier-duty job box.

Your garage should be organized. You want to be able quickly and easily access the materials and tools you need without having to look through boxes or bins. For tools that are out of reach, overhead storage racks are also a good option.


A pegboard is another option. These boards are great for storage of lightweight tools, which don't need to be hung up on a wall, and small containers that have screws, nuts, bolts, and other hardware.

After you have organized your workshop it is essential to ensure it is well ventilated, and that it is lit. Do not work in a darkened or cramped environment that can lead to injury, or even death.

Make sure you have enough natural light and adequate lighting over your work area. This will make your job easier and prevent any accidents.

Depending on the job you have in mind, you might need different tools for your workshop. For example, if you plan to work with metal, you might need a chop saw or an arc welder.

If you plan to do some painting or staining, you might need to have some chemicals and paints around to help you get the job done right. You will be able to easily find the supplies you need and perform repairs.

Also, you can install a ventilation system to your workshop. This will ensure that the air is fresh and not toxic. You can either have a window screen to control the amount of air that comes in or you can install an exhaust fan to ensure that dust and debris is properly removed from the work area.

What is the difference between a remodel and a renovation?

A remodel is major renovation to a room, or a portion of a rooms. A renovation involves minor changes to a specific room or part of it. Remodeling a bathroom is a major job, but adding a faucet to the sink is a minor one.

Remodeling entails the replacement of an entire room, or a portion thereof. A renovation is only changing something about a room or a part. Remodeling a kitchen could mean replacing countertops, sinks or appliances. It also involves changing the lighting, colors and accessories. You could also update your kitchen by painting the walls, or installing new light fixtures.
